Sherghati Assembly constituency is an assembly constituency for Bihar Legislative Assembly in Gaya district of Bihar, India.
It comes under Gaya (Lok Sabha constituency).

Year | Member | Party | |
---|---|---|---|
1957 | Shahjehan Mohammad | Indian National Congress | |
1962 | |||
1967 | M. A. Khan | Jan Kranti Dal | |
1969 | Jairam Giri | Independent | |
1972 | Indian National Congress | ||
1977-2010 : Constituency did not exist | |||
2010 | Vinod Prasad Yadav | Janata Dal (United) | |
2015 | |||
2020 | Manju Agrawal | Rashtriya Janata Dal |
